Lights can add that lived-in feeling to your model railroad scenes. However finding the right lights, providing the correct power supply, calculating dropping resistor values, and doing all the wiring can get tedious. However DCC Concept's new Cobalt Alpha Mimic structure lighting kit can make this process pretty close to plug and play requiring soldering only a couple of wires. In this video I'll show you what comes in the packages and demonstrate what it takes to light up your structures in just a few minutes.
